1) Information disclosure (CVE-ID: CVE-2019-1280)
CWE-ID: CWE-200 - Exposure of sensitive information to an unauthorized actor
CVSSv4: C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:P/PR:N/UI:A/VC:H/VI:H/VA:H/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N/E:U/U:Green
The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to execute arbitrary code on the target system.
The vulnerability exists due to improper input validation when processing .LNK files. A remote attacker can trick the victim to open a network location or a USB drive with specially crafted LNK file present in it and execute arbitrary code on the system with privileges of the current user.
